It is said that this was the first time edge rails were used! …” And see the related notes on the Kidderminster rail in Circular 37 and Railway & Canal Historical Society, Early Railway Group Occasional Paper [ERG OP]256, Rowan Patel, ‘Butterley Company Edge Rails: their use at Belvoir Castle and elsewhere’. ____________________________ The Leicester Navigationʼs Forest Line: a myth debunked Michael Lewis One of the least successful projects of the Canal Mania was the Charnwood Forest Line of the Leicester Navigation, which was intended to bring coal from pits around Coleorton to the main waterway at Loughborough. It was to be a hybrid transport route, with railways on the steeper stretches at each end but a canal on the level central portion. “The bodies of the Trams were made to lift off, or to be placed on their wheels, by means of cranes” and stowed in canal boats1: an early instance of containerisation. And not only was the system a fiasco, but there are few early railways whose story has been more befogged by misinformation and misinterpretation. Although the general outline was elucidated in an invaluable paper of 19552, until recently the nature of the rails has remained obscure, for none has been found in the field. -

The Robert Stephenson Trust – Publications Robert Stephenson – Engineer & Scientist – The Making of a Prodigy by Victoria Haworth 185 x 285 90pp ISBN 0 9535 1621 0 Softback £9.95 postage & packing £1.50 The work of Robert Stephenson has always been overshadowed by that of his father George and the author attempts to lay to rest the confusion that various myths have created. The book highlights Robert’s formative years and his major contribution to the development of the steam locomotive design, including notable locomotives such as Rocket, Planet and Patentee . The factory in Newcastle, which bears his name, not only produced these machines but trained talents in abundance, changing the face of civilisation. Also included is a chronology of the main events in his life. Robert Stephenson: Railway Engineer by John Addyman & Victoria Haworth A4 195pp ISBN 1 873513 60 7 Hardback £19.95 postage & packing £5.00 This biography seeks to return Robert Stephenson to his rightful position as the pre-eminent engineer of the Railway Age. The book surveys the whole range of his railway work and aims to correct the imbalance due to Smiles who credited most of Robert’s early work to his father George. All aspects of his work are covered, from very important locomotive development to railway building and consultancy around the world. Fully referenced primary sources and well reproduced lithographs, drawings and other art work complement this essential reference book. Hackworth Family Archive A cataloguing project made possible by the National Cataloguing Grants Programme for Archives Science Museum Group 1 Description of Entire Archive: HACK (fonds level description) Title Hackworth Family Archive Fonds reference code GB 0756 HACK Dates 1810’s-1980’s Extent & Medium of the unit of the 1036 letters with accompanying letters and associated documents, 151 pieces of printed material and printed images, unit of description 13 volumes, 6 drawings, 4 large items Name of creator s Hackworth Family Administrative/Biographical Hackworth, Timothy (b 1786 – d 1850), Railway Engineer was an early railway pioneer who worked for the Stockton History and Darlington Railway Company and had his own engineering works Soho Works, in Shildon, County Durham. He married and had eight children and was a converted Wesleyan Methodist. He manufactured and designed locomotives and other engines and worked with other significant railway individuals of the time, for example George and Robert Stephenson. He was responsible for manufacturing the first locomotive for Russia and British North America. It has been debated historically up to the present day whether Hackworth gained enough recognition for his work. Proponents of Hackworth have suggested that he invented of the ‘blast pipe’ which led to the success of locomotives over other forms of rail transport. His sons other relatives went on to be engineers. His eldest son, John Wesley Hackworth did a lot of work to promote his fathers memory after he died. His daughters, friends, grandchildren, great-grandchildren and ancestors to this day have worked to try and gain him a prominent place in railway history.
